Those look very clean and smooth, what kind of casting did you guys do?

I mostly use Amazing Mold/Resin (found in Hobby Lobby/Michaels/AC Moore arts and crafts stores, or Amazon), while my brother uses Moldmaking starter kits.

The mold making kit I use:

Mold Process 1.jpg

Some old molds:

Mold Process 2.png

My brother's kit of choice:

Moldmaking & Casting Pourable Starter Kit.png

Both work well, you can make a lot more using my brother's method though. Just be careful and use gloves when mixing the materials.

Both types have good casting quality, but expect lots of mold lines and air bubbles to fix afterwards. Everything I cast is 100% for my own use, so I don't mind the quality as I can always fix it with clay (my brother is getting good at using green stuff to make fur to fill in gaps). Or if you are looking for a run-down look that work great too.

Army Size Planning:

When I finally decided on the battle and using square bases, I was very curious to see just how big of an army I could eventually create (given enough time, money, time, painting skill, and time). I decided to do a little powerpoint-wizardry to make paper tiles to mark each unit that I could possibly make to create this army in 28mm.

View attachment 46183

Here are the block sizes I was working with:

Infantry (missile ashigaru, spear ashigaru, foot samurai): 40 x 40 mm; 4x infantry per base
Cavalry (samurai): 50 x 50 mm; 2 mounted samurai per base

Each tile has a picture of the clans I have been researching.
Western Army Clans: coalition of Ishida, Ukita, Konishi, Shimazu, Otani, and others

View attachment 46184


Western Army Traitors: Kobayakawa and allies (who turned the tide of the fighting in favor of Tokugawa)

View attachment 46185


Eastern Army: Tokugawa and his generals

View attachment 46186


Western Army: Rear Forces of the Mori Clan (who in real life never joined the battle)

View attachment 46187
